What are actually PVC and also TPO Roofing Membranes?
Understanding PVC Roofing
PVC is actually a type of plastic that has actually been actually widely utilized in several markets for many years. As a roofing component, it delivers toughness, protection to chemicals, as well as superb water-proofing abilities. PVC roofing membranes are usually white or light-colored, which assists demonstrate sun light and also minimize power costs.
Understanding TPO Roofing
TPO is actually a latest polycarbonate single-ply membrane layer that integrates polypropylene and ethylene-propylene rubber. This roofing product has actually acquired level of popularity as a result of its own adaptability, affordability, and power effectiveness. TPO roof coverings are commonly accessible in white colored, gray, or black options.
The Structure of PVC vs TPO
Chemical Structure of PVC
- Made mainly coming from polyvinyl chloride Contains ingredients for versatility and also UV resistance Typically improved with fiberglass
Chemical Make-up of TPO
- Composed of polypropylene and ethylene-propylene rubber UV-resistant components Often enhanced along with polyester fabric
Durability: PVC vs TPO
Lifespan of PVC Membranes
PVC roof coverings can easily last anywhere from twenty to 30 years when correctly sustained. Their longevity is actually a considerable marketing aspect as they may endure harsh weather condition conditions.
Lifespan of TPO Membranes
TPO membranes normally have a life expectancy of around 15 to 25 years. Although they may not last as long as PVC rooftops, proper servicing may stretch their life significantly.

Cost Review: Installment Costs for Business Roofs
How A lot Does It Price to Set Up PVC?
The normal price for putting in a PVC roofing system varies coming from $7 to $12 per square feet. Factors affecting this cost include work costs, difficulty of setup, and also geographic location.
How Much Does It Cost to Put Up TPO?
TPO roofing has a tendency to be much more affordable than PVC, along with installment costs ranging coming from $5 to $10 every square foot. Despite being more economical upfront, it is actually essential to consider lasting functionality when making your decision.
